Output 8d98131d23d30e93f81f859f02194a3990ef7dcef0e72b409b5f75340d674af5:134

value
129651
script pubkey
OP_0 OP_PUSHBYTES_32 d7276383c6a30f631f9118fda69a7f38ac68a0735ba18758e94dd1e02a2f04ac
address
bc1q6unk8q7x5v8kx8u3rr76dxnl8zkx3grntwscwk8ffhg7q230qjkqaes0tt
transaction
8d98131d23d30e93f81f859f02194a3990ef7dcef0e72b409b5f75340d674af5
spent
true